Stop Wasting Money: Simple Saving Tips You Can Use Today

Want to boost your savings situation? It's easier than you think! Start by tracking where your money is going. Create a financial roadmap and stick to it as much as possible. Explore cutting back on nonessential expenses like daily coffee runs or costly subscriptions you barely use. Every little bit adds up.

  • Form a savings goal and schedule regular transfers to your nest egg account.
  • Shop around for cheaper prices on necessities and utilize of sales whenever possible.
  • Cook meals at home instead of ordering takeout to reduce expenses.

Achieving Frugal Living on a Budget

Living frugally doesn't have to be limiting. It's about being conscious with your dollars, making smart choices that allow you to extend your money. With a little planning, you can enjoy a fulfilling lifestyle without breaking the bank.

Start by establishing a comprehensive budget that tracks your income and expenses. This will give you a clear overview of where your money is going and identify areas where you can cut back.

Next, explore ways to minimize your everyday expenses. Discuss lower rates on your bills, look for deals for groceries and household items, and discover entertainment alternatives.

Remember, frugal living is a journey that requires persistence. By making small, consistent changes, you can accomplish your financial goals and enjoy the freedom that comes with it.
